Scrapy crawl baike
Web2 days ago · The CrawlerRunner object must be instantiated with a :class:`~scrapy.settings.Settings` object. This class shouldn't be needed (since Scrapy is … WebApr 13, 2024 · Scrapy intègre de manière native des fonctions pour extraire des données de sources HTML ou XML en utilisant des expressions CSS et XPath. Quelques avantages de Scrapy : Efficace en termes de mémoire et de CPU. Fonctions intégrées pour l’extraction de données. Facilement extensible pour des projets de grande envergure.
Scrapy crawl baike
Did you know?
WebOct 26, 2015 · from scrapy.crawler import CrawlerProcess from scrapy.utils.project import get_project_settings process = CrawlerProcess(get_project_settings()) … Web需求和上次一样,只是职位信息和详情内容分开保存到不同的文件,并且获取下一页和详情页的链接方式有改动。 这次用到了CrawlSpider。 class scrapy.spiders.CrawlSpider它是Spider的派生类,Spider类的设计原则是只爬取start_url列表中的网页,而CrawlSpider类定义了一些规则(rule)来提供跟进link的方便的机制,从爬 ...
WebApr 12, 2024 · Scrapy lets us determine how we want the spider to crawl, what information we want to extract, and how we can extract it. Specifically, Spiders are Python classes where we’ll put all of our custom logic and behavior. import scrapy class NewsSpider(scrapy.Spider): name = 'news' ... WebMar 7, 2024 · Scrapy, an open-source scraper framework written in Python, is one of the most popular choices for such purpose. After writing a handful of scrapers for our projects, I learnt to use some tricks...
WebJul 18, 2024 · The way scrapy works is through an engine that manages granularly every step of the crawling process. The project is thus divided in several files that serve different purposes: \fbcrawl README.md -- this file scrapy.cfg -- ini-style file that defines the project \fbcrawl _ init.py _ items.py -- defines the fields that we want to export WebMar 11, 2024 · Scrapy is a free and open-source web crawling framework written in Python. It is a fast, high-level framework used to crawl websites and extract structured data from their pages. It can be used for a wide range of purposes, from data mining to monitoring and automated testing.
Web以前的答案是正確的,但您不必每次要編寫scrapy 的蜘蛛代碼時都聲明構造函數( __init__ ),您可以像以前一樣指定參數: scrapy crawl myspider -a parameter1=value1 -a parameter2=value2
WebScrapy 解析结果中的链接的碎片列表 scrapy python scrapy 302(我想返回原始页面) scrapy Scrapy-下载response.body时不同的页面内容 scrapy drive through blood sheffieldWebAug 5, 2024 · import scrapy class SephoraItem (scrapy.Item): name = scrapy.Field () price = scrapy.Field () The command I used to get the result along with a csv output is: scrapy crawl sephorasp -o items.csv -t csv python python-3.x web-scraping xpath scrapy Share Improve this question Follow asked Aug 5, 2024 at 16:33 SIM 2,471 1 22 47 Add a comment 1 … drive through beer storeWebSep 13, 2024 · Scrapy is a web crawling framework which does most of the heavy lifting in developing a web crawler. You can build and run the web crawler in a fast and simple way. Why Docker? Docker is a tool designed to create, … drive through beer barn near me